"Fabrice and Valerie Closset-Gaziaux both have educational backgrounds in agronomy and earth sciences. After having spent extensive time working to develop sustainable farming practices in Africa and then helping growers in the Loire develop organic and naturally balanced vineyards for 8 years, they decided (in 2008) to procure vineyards in South-Revermont, in the “premier plateau” of Jura.
Cuvee notes: Plenty of ripe fruit keeps this this zero dosage Crémant from being overly austere. Champ Divin's farmer fizz gets all of the first pass (early picked) fruit, and then only free run juice."
